Knoxville, Tennessee vs. Monroe, North Carolina

Cost of Living Comparison

The cost of living in Monroe, North Carolina is 5.4% more expensive than Knoxville, Tennessee.

You would need a salary of $52,679 in Monroe, North Carolina to maintain the standard of living you have in Knoxville, Tennessee.
Comparison highlights
• Overall, Monroe, North Carolina is more expensive than Knoxville, Tennessee
• Taxes is the biggest factor in the cost of living difference.
